Transaction 705051151a5fec18a2fbf85f21f2e4355959cbe01a026e0ba4ce60fc84edb810

1 Input
2 Outputs
  • 705051151a5fec18a2fbf85f21f2e4355959cbe01a026e0ba4ce60fc84edb810:0
  • value  3790850
    address  3CxUhCYj8MrKup3xHmbgBkSGzvbZQb11Nd
  • 705051151a5fec18a2fbf85f21f2e4355959cbe01a026e0ba4ce60fc84edb810:1
  • value  76362619
    address  1JryaSaWdHPWJpzB67Bf7MSYsS5dCV6D3w